Chandigarh police are on high alert after a couple of bullet shells were discovered on the bus that was transporting Sri Lankan players from Hotel Lalit to R S Bindra Cricket Stadium in Mohali.

A routine check was conducted by the police on Saturday when they happened to come across two bullet shells in the luggage compartment of the private bus. They were using metal detectors when the discovery was made.

As of now, no FIR has been registered but a DDR was written. The bus was parked inside the hotel complex under the IT Park Police Station. Notably, the investigation has confirmed that the bus was hired from Tara Brothers operating in Sector 17, Chandigarh.

The officials haven’t revealed details about the cartridges used. The SHO of the Police Station, Shadilal, stayed away from the cameras and hasn’t spoken about the shells yet.

They questioned the bus driver and the owners but nothing has been found yet. A theory runs that the bus was hired for a marriage function in Punjab where celebratory gun firing is common practice.

But the police haven’t been able to confirm the news about the same or how the luggage compartment is where the shells landed.

The T20I series is ongoing between India and Sri Lanka where the hosts are leading 2-0 with a game to be played. After the T20s, they will play the two Tests scheduled in Mohali and Bengaluru.
